E-Challan Machines launched at Dilaram Chowk in Dehradun

Friday, 23 August 2019 | PNS | DEHRADUN

Dehradun Senior Superintendent of Police (SSP) Arun Mohan Joshi launched the new e-challan machines on Thursday at Dilaram Chowk.

Deputy Inspector General (traffic) Keval Khurana said, “The e-challan machines have been distributed in Dehradun district on an experimental basis. If they get good results they will be distributed in other districts also.” SSP Joshi said, “This E-challan machine will bring transparency in the work operation of police department. The machines are connected with the software of National Informatics Centre (NIC) that has been specially developed. Through this we can also mark people who are repeatedly being issued challan. Also, it will be easier to keep a track of challans issued by particular police personnel as they will be having unique login and password.”He also informed that with the use of e-challan machine people will be able to pay the fine through online mode. There will be a unique QR ID through which it will be possible to pay through applications such as Paytm and Google Pay.

According to the information provided by local police, first e-challan of Rs 100 was issued to Arun Kumar, a resident of Kanwli Road. He was driving a vehicle without number plate. It is to mention that on July 6, 13 of the 136 e-challan machines were distributed to the members of City Patrol Unit (CPU) in Dehradun. SP traffic Arya said that CPU is already familiar with the technicalities of this machine, which is why the 13 E-challan machines were given to them on trial basis. Now all the e-challan machines have been distributed to police stations. The number of machines varies according to the population in each area.
